Fernando Gonzalez: Thanks, Lucy, and good day to everyone. I am pleased with our first quarter results, which outperformed our expectations underlying our 2024 guidance. In fact, EBITDA represents a first quarter record for the company. Despite fewer working days and difficult weather conditions in many markets, EBITDA grew 5%. Three of our four regions markets accounting for 90% of consolidated EBITDA, experienced a combined growth rate of 15%. Mexico deserves special mention, setting a record in terms of quarterly EBITDA generation. EBITDA margin expanded year-over-year and sequentially, driven by a favorable price cost dynamic. Our prices rose mid-single digits, while input cost inflation slowed. Growth investments and urbanization solutions continue to materially support EBITDA growth.

Net income grew 13%. Our return on capital 2.4%, was slightly higher relative to the same period last year despite the impact of the Spanish tax fine that we recognized in fourth quarter 2023. In other highlights, last month, we achieved an important milestone with the receipt of an investment-grade rating of BBB- from Standard & Poors. This rating action was recognition of our medium-term financial strategy as well as consistent financial performance. In late March, we hosted our 2024 CEMEX Day presenting additional insights into our regions, decarbonization progress and goals, capital allocation and strategy. I would encourage you to access the replay on our website. This month, we refinanced our Eurobank facility, further improving our maturity schedule and liquidity position.

In March, we published our eighth integrated report as we continue to set the pace for our industry towards a profitable climate action transition. As part of our portfolio rebalancing efforts, we have announced an agreement to divest our interest assets and operations in the Philippines for a total enterprise value of $800 million. We currently expect to finalize this transaction before the end of year, aligned to our strategy. The majority of divestment proceeds would be repurposed to fund our growth strategy in the U.S. market. Net sales rose 3% with increases in Mexico and [indiscernible] partially offset by volume declines in the U.S. and EMEA. EBITDA rose mid-single digits, reflecting growth in Mexico, SAC and the U.S. We estimate that the impact of fewer working days in the quarter amounted to an additional $20 million in EBITDA or 3% in year-over-year growth.
